Reason for Recall
As stated by NHTSA
Tremcar is recalling certain 2018-2020 406 and 707 semi-trailers. The washers used for mounting the brake actuators may fracture, allowing the actuators to loosen, potentially reducing the braking ability.
Reported concern (NHTSA)
A reduction in the braking performance can lengthen the distance needed to stop the vehicle, increasing the risk of a crash.
Recommended Action
Per NHTSA guidance
Tremcar will notify owners, and TSE Brakes will provide replacement brake actuator mounting washers and nuts, free of charge. The recall began March 30, 2020. Owners may contact Tremcar customer service at 1-800-363-2158.
